Define the measurement decision

Use within-panel comparisons first. Cross-company or industry claims need consistent collection and disclosed exclusions.

Measurement method

StepAction
1Freeze the benchmark prompt set and publish its scope
2Count scheduled, successful, failed, and excluded observations
3Calculate brand coverage within successful responses using a stated denominator
4Compare position, Sentiment, and citations as separate dimensions
5Show uncertainty and avoid ranking tiny differences as meaningful

Worked calculation or observation

If Brand A appears in 12 of 20 successful purchase prompts and Brand B in 11, the difference may not justify a strategic claim. Reading the answers and sources may reveal a more actionable distinction.

Evidence to retain for brand-visibility benchmarking in AI answers

Keep these fields with the decision:

  • metric name
  • numerator
  • denominator
  • scope
  • platform
  • Prompt Group
  • success state
  • observation date
  • formula version

Limits and UnderAI's role in brand-visibility benchmarking in AI answers

Benchmarks cannot be generalized beyond their prompts, dates, platforms, and markets. They also do not prove future performance.
